How far is Slidell, LA from Laplace, LA?

Fastest route

The distance between Slidell, Louisiana and Laplace, Louisiana is approximately 56.2 miles (90.3 kilometers). The fastest route is via I-10 W, and the estimated travel time is 57 minutes.

Directions

To get from Slidell to Laplace, follow these directions:

  1. Head east on Bouscaren St toward 3rd St/Sergeant Alfred Dr/Sgt Alfred St.
  2. Turn right onto 3rd St/Sergeant Alfred Dr/Sgt Alfred St.
  3. Turn left onto Slidell Ave.
  4. Turn left onto Old Spanish Trail.
  5. Use the right lane to merge onto I-10 W via the ramp to New Orleans.
  6. Follow I-10 W and take exit 209 for US-51 toward Laplace.
  7. Drive to Main St in LaPlace.
